Kinds of Headphones
Headphones can be broadly classified into a number of types, each developed to cater to various listening requirements and environments. Below is a summary of the most typical types of headphones available in the UK:
Type | Description | Suitable For |
---|---|---|
Over-Ear | These headphones cover the whole ear, providing remarkable sound isolation and comfort. | Audiophiles, gamers, and music manufacturers. |
On-Ear | Smaller sized than over-ear headphones, they rest on the ears and provide a more portable choice. | Commuters and casual listeners. |
In-Ear | Also referred to as earbuds, they fit directly in the ear canal and are highly portable. | Fitness lovers and travelers. |
Noise-Cancelling | Equipped with innovation to eliminate background noise, improving the listening experience. | Frequent flyers and hectic city residents. |
Open-Back | These headphones allow air and sound to travel through the ear cups, producing a natural listening experience. | Home listeners and audiophiles who choose openness. |
Wireless | Making use of Bluetooth technology, these headphones eliminate cable televisions for added mobility. | Users who prioritize convenience and movement. |

Frequently asked questions
1. What is the difference between wired and wireless headphones?
Wired headphones link to gadgets through a cable television, typically offering Cost Of Headphones lower latency and no need for charging. Wireless headphones use Bluetooth, providing liberty of movement but frequently requiring battery charging.
2. Do noise-cancelling headphones block all external sounds?
No, noise-cancelling headphones considerably decrease ambient sound but may not obstruct all sounds. They are especially effective for low-frequency noises like engine sounds.
3. How can I enhance sound quality while using headphones?
To improve sound quality, utilize premium audio files, make sure a good suitable for proper sound isolation, and think about using a digital-to-analog converter (DAC) for wired headphones.
